What Is Seamless Underwear?

The Technology Behind Seamless Design

Seamless underwear is created using advanced knitting or raw-cut fabric techniques that eliminate stitched seams and bulky finishes. Instead of traditional hems, edges are laser-cut or bonded, creating a smooth, barely-there feel against the skin.

How Seamless Underwear Feels

Seamless underwear typically feels lightweight, stretchy, and flexible. Because there are no sewn-in seams, it moves with your body without bunching or rubbing. It’s ideal for sensitive skin or anyone who wants minimal texture.


Why Seamless Has Become So Popular

Invisible Under Clothing

One of the biggest advantages of seamless underwear is the complete lack of visible panty lines (VPL). Raw-cut edges sit flush against the skin, making seamless styles perfect under leggings, dresses, and tailored pants.


Lightweight and Flexible

Because seamless underwear relies on stretchy, smooth fabrics, it offers a weightless feel. It moves with your body rather than against it, reducing digging and discomfort.


Breathable for All-Day Wear

Many seamless designs use lightweight microfiber or performance blends, making them breathable and ideal for active days or warm weather.


Ideal for Sensitive Skin

Without bulky seams, stitching, or elastics, seamless underwear minimizes friction and irritation—perfect for those with sensitivities.


What Is Traditional Underwear?

Classic Construction and Structure

Traditional underwear is made using cut-and-sew construction, which means the fabric pieces are stitched together with seams, hems, and elastic trims. This allows for more structure, shaping, and design variety.


The Feel of Traditional Styles

Traditional underwear can feel more secure, especially for those who prefer a more defined fit around the waistband or leg openings. The added structure can offer a cozy, supportive sensation.

Key Differences: Seamless vs. Traditional

Appearance Under Clothing

  • Seamless: Completely invisible; best for smooth silhouettes.

Traditional: Can be invisible too, depending on the fabric, cut, and fit. Thin, soft materials can still disappear under clothing.


Comfort Profile

  • Seamless: Weightless, soft, zero irritation.

  • Traditional: Slightly more structure with a secure feel.

Fit and Stretch

  • Seamless: Often has more stretch and adapts to a wider range of body shapes.

  • Traditional: Offers consistent shape and a more sculpted fit.

Durability

Both styles are durable when crafted with high-quality fabrics, but seamless underwear requires proper washing to prevent raw edges from wearing prematurely.

Care Considerations for Each Type

Seamless Underwear Care Tips

  • Wash cold, preferably in a mesh bag

  • Avoid fabric softeners (they weaken elastane)

  • Always air-dry to protect raw edges


Traditional Underwear Care Tips

  • Can often handle machine wash cycles

  • Still best washed cold

  • Also air-dry to preserve elasticity and shape

Both types benefit from gentle care to extend longevity, especially in premium fabrics.
